What reason do historians usually give for early English victories durning the Hundred Years War?

They were technologically superior.

By this I mean technologically superior for the time period. The English possessed the better weapons. For example they had the long bows which were better than the normal bows as well as cannons which is something that turned many of the battles in their favor.
